Logan David Brooks
01/30/81 - 02/23/05
                                         

Logan was a revolutionary. 
An Anarchist.  A vegan.
A believer in the ability of the human race to establish true freedom, true equality, for all; human and non-human.
He was my husband, my life, my love.

Logan's Library and Roving Radical Infoshop was started by Logan as an Infoshop but after his death I turned it into a library, wanting to keep it sacred for our children.  Logan devoured books like most people devour the air that sustains them.  He took all the knowledge found in them and used it to spread Anarchism, Love, and Peace.  Other endeavours of his included Critical Resistance, St. Pete Food Not Bombs, St. Pete for Peace.  He helped out with the Mid-Pinellas Homeless Outreach Center and the Uhuru Movement.  He worked tirelessly to end all oppression, especially that perpetrated by the United States Government all around the world. 

I will never know what books Logan would have ordered for the Infoshop, beyond those that he'd already got.  I hope that the directions I've taken it in are okay with him! 

  Logan left his physical body on February 23rd 2005 after a 4 day battle to overcome the massive brain trauma that he received from a car crash.  He was on his way home from an organizing meeting for a March 19th anti-oppression rally held in Williams Park, St. Petersburg.  He is missed sooo much.   To learn more about this amazing man, you can go to his Livejournal account or his MySpace account.    The Livejournal account was started by him and includes his thoughts up to his death (entries prior to Feb. 23rd 2005) and is updated by me (entries since) with writings he left in composition books and pictures of him.  The MySpace account gives a great breakdown of his interests.  He was and is a Beautiful Man.  The best husband a girl could ever ask for, the best father any child could ever dream of.
